ExecutionScope.IsolateExpression Method

Microsoft Silverlight will reach end of support after October 2021. Learn more.

This API supports the .NET Framework infrastructure and is not intended to be used directly from your code.

Frees a specified expression tree of external parameter references by replacing the parameter with its current value.

Namespace:  System.Runtime.CompilerServices
Assembly:  System.Core (in System.Core.dll)
